- MOVIETONE CARD TITLE: Troops Airlift to Canal Zone. DESCRIPTION: A number of Britannias were recently made ready as troop transports for the Mediterranean airlift. Infantrymen went aboard Britannias at Hurn Airport, were the first British troops to be flown overseas in the luxurious comfort of a turbo-prop airliner. SHOTLIST: TPS of a Britannia in a hangar. CU Britannia nameplate. Men bringing out single seats and then carrying up seats which hold 3 passengers. Men fitting seats and fitting covers onto the luggage rack. Interior shot down the length of the plane. Slip pan to various shots of Infantrymen boarding a Britannia at Hurn Airport. Britannia taxiing.
